Antwerpen Port: Antwerpen Port is the largest port in Belgium and one of the largest in Europe. It is strategically located on the Scheldt River, offering access to major European markets. The port handles a wide range of cargo, including containers, liquid bulk, dry bulk, and breakbulk. It is known for its efficient infrastructure and excellent connectivity to the hinterland.
Brussels Port: Brussels Port is a smaller port located on the Brussels-Charleroi Canal. It primarily handles inland shipping and is important for the transportation of goods within Belgium. The port plays a key role in the region's logistics network, facilitating the movement of goods to and from the capital city.
Genk Port: Genk Port is a specialized inland port that focuses on the handling of bulk cargo, particularly coal, minerals, and agricultural products. It is connected to the Albert Canal, providing access to the Port of Antwerp and the wider European waterway network. Genk Port plays a vital role in supporting the industrial activities in the region.
Ghent Port: Ghent Port is a major seaport located on the Ghent-Terneuzen Canal. It is one of the largest ports in Belgium in terms of total cargo throughput. The port handles a diverse range of goods, including containers, bulk cargo, and project cargo. Ghent Port is known for its efficient multimodal connections, linking it to major European markets.
Liege Port: Liege Port is an inland port situated on the Meuse River. It is the largest public port in Belgium and serves as an important logistics hub for the region. The port specializes in container handling, steel products, and chemicals. Liege Port benefits from its central location in Europe and its multimodal transport connections.
Other ports in Belgium include Zeebrugge Port, which is a key commercial and container port on the North Sea coast. It specializes in ro-ro traffic, containers, and bulk cargo, serving as a gateway to the UK and Scandinavia.
- Manila Port: Manila Port is the largest and busiest port in the Philippines, located in the capital city of Manila. It serves as the main gateway for international trade in the country, handling a wide range of cargo including containers, bulk, and breakbulk. The port is equipped with modern facilities and infrastructure to accommodate large vessels.
- Cebu City Port: Cebu City Port is a major seaport located in the central Visayas region of the Philippines. It is an important hub for domestic shipping and also handles some international cargo. The port plays a key role in connecting the different islands of the Philippines through ferry services.
- Davao Port: Davao Port is the main port serving the southern island of Mindanao. It is a strategic gateway for trade in the region, handling a variety of cargo including agricultural products, minerals, and general goods. The port is well-equipped to handle containerized cargo and bulk shipments.
- General Santos Port: General Santos Port is another key port located in Mindanao, specifically in the city of General Santos. The port primarily handles exports of agricultural products such as bananas, pineapples, and tuna. It is an important economic center for the region and plays a vital role in the country's trade.
- Subic Bay Port: Subic Bay Port is a former US naval base that has been converted into a major commercial port. It is strategically located near Manila and serves as an alternative to the congested Manila Port. The port is known for its modern facilities and efficient operations, particularly in handling containerized cargo.
- Other ports in the Philippines include Batangas Port in Luzon, Luzon Port in the northern region, Cagayan De Oro Port in Mindanao. These ports also play important roles in the country's maritime trade, catering to various types of cargo and vessels.

LCL from Belgium to Philippines (Less than Container Load):
For smaller shipments that don't fill an entire container, our LCL service is the perfect solution. We consolidate multiple shipments into one container, saving you time and money. With regular departures to Philippines from Belgium. Your cargo will reach its destination securely and on schedule.
FCL from Belgium to Philippines (Full Container Load):
If you have enough cargo to fill a whole container, our FCL service offers exclusive use of a container. This ensures your goods remain secure and minimizes the risk of damage during transit. Choose to 20 FT, 40 FT, or 40 HC containers, depending on the volume and nature of your cargo.

For container transportation from Belgium to Philippines, various factors come into play. The size of the shipping container, the type of goods to be shipped, distance of the destination, and the shipping method (either Full Container Load or Less than Container Load) all directly affect the cost.
When shipping cargo from Belgium to the Philippines, the average transit time for sea freight is approximately 30-40 days. This time frame can vary depending on factors such as the specific ports of departure and arrival, the distance between the two countries, and the efficiency of logistics services involved in the shipment. Longer distances and more complex logistics can lead to longer transit times, while more direct routes and streamlined processes can expedite the shipping process. Additionally, inclement weather conditions or unforeseen delays in port operations can also impact the overall transit time for cargo shipments.
Customs procedures in both Belgium and the Philippines can add some additional time to the shipping process. In Belgium, customs clearance typically takes around 2-3 days, while in the Philippines, it can take approximately 3-5 days for cargo to clear customs. These time frames are average estimates and can vary depending on the specific circumstances of each shipment.
